PostgreSQL: How to Combine Data from 2 Tables (4 examples)
Introduction In the realm of database management, PostgreSQL stands out for its robust features and flexibility. One common task that database administrators and developers often encounter is combining…
Using cursor-based pagination in PostgreSQL: Step-by-Step Guide
Overview When dealing with large datasets in PostgreSQL, traditional offset-based pagination becomes inefficient and slow, negatively impacting performance and user experience. A more efficient alternative is cursor-based pagination,…
PostgreSQL: How to reset the auto-increment value of a column
Introduction PostgreSQL offers powerful data storage capabilities, but managing auto-increment values, especially in SERIAL or IDENTITY columns, is a common challenge that developers face. It’s crucial to understand…
PostgreSQL: How to add a calculated column in SELECT query
Introduction In the realm of relational database systems, PostgreSQL stands out for its robustness, flexibility, and compatibility with standards. One of the powerful features of PostgreSQL is the…
PostgreSQL: How to Drop FOREIGN KEY Constraints
Working with databases often requires you to modify the schema to adapt to changes in your application’s structure or logic. One common task you may encounter is the…
Composite Indexes in PostgreSQL: Explained with Examples
Mastering database efficiency often necessitates a deep dive into the mechanics of indexing. In PostgreSQL, one of the powerful features available to developers and database administrators (DBAs) for…
Exploring GIN (Generalized Inverted Indexes) in PostgreSQL (with Examples)
PostgreSQL, renowned for its extensibility and compliance with SQL standards, offers a variety of indexing techniques to optimize query performance on large datasets. Among these, Generalized Inverted Indexes…
Custom Collations and Types in PostgreSQL: The Complete Guide
Overview When working with PostgreSQL, understanding the in-built types and collations can drastically improve your data manipulation capabilities. However, when dealing with unique data sets and internationalization requirements,…
Understanding Hash Indexes in PostgreSQL
PostgreSQL, the advanced open-source database management system, offers a multitude of indexing strategies to optimize query performance. Among the various index types, the hash index stands out for…
PostgreSQL GiST (Generalized Search Tree) Indexes: Explained with Examples
Overview PostgreSQL is renowned for its robust performance, optimal scalability, and extensive customization capabilities. Among its powerful features are the indexing mechanisms it offers. In this article, we…